I recently upgraded to a 9070 XT GPU, and I noticed it requires 3x 8-Pin PCIe connectors. Unfortunately, I only have cables that distribute 2x 8-Pin connectors on one cable. Can I safely connect one of those cables as a third 8-Pin for my new GPU?

You can definitely use a pigtail connector for this. It's a common practice, and many people do it without issues. Just ensure you keep an eye on temperature and power draw just in case.
